Question: Do you support gene editing? How do you feel about gene editing for non or less fatal issues like depression, dyslexia, autism, or obesity?
Answer: Gene editing is a process through which more enhanced result can be obtained. In this process the gene is edited, modified or eliminated. The genetic engineering has developed better opportunity for the people who are suffering from chronic diseases. The genes can be modified to obtained specific or particular results in human.
So, gene editing is one of the beneficial technology. It is used to improve health condition of the patients. The gene editing for less fatal diseases should also be implemented because these less fatal disease results in to chronic problems if not treated properly. For example in the case of obesity, if the obesity is not treated or weight is not managed then it may cause cardiovascular disease, diabetes etc.
